The LR43 battery has an average capacity of 80-90 mAh, which is comparable to the LR44 battery’s capacity of 110-130 mAh. R44 battery is a round cell with a diameter of 11.6 mm and a height of 5.4 mm, according to IEC standard 60086-3. LR denotes a round alkaline battery, whereas CR denotes a round lithium battery. The LR44 and LR43 batteries are quite similar. The physical dimensions of the LR43 battery are 11.6×4.2 mm, which is 1.2 mm shorter than the height of the LR44 cell. The LR44 battery has a maximum self-discharge rate of 10% per year, which is one of the reasons why they are also used as motherboard batteries, but the CR2032 battery is more commonly utilized. The LR41 battery cannot be used to replace the LR44 battery due to physical variances; however, a plastic spacer ring (battery holder) might potentially be used to properly position the LR41 battery in the battery compartment designed for the LR44 battery.

The SR42 battery has a nominal capacity of 1.55 volts, a cutoff voltage of 1.2 volts, and a nominal capacity of 60-100 mAh; it has a more consistent output voltage than the LR44 battery but a somewhat smaller capacity.

The LR44 battery is the same size as silver oxide button batteries such the SR44SW, 357, 303, and SR44, but it has a different chemistry.

The LR41 battery is an alkaline button/coin cell with physical dimensions of 7.9 x 3.6 mm, a nominal voltage of 1.5V, a cutoff voltage of 0.9-1.0V, and a nominal capacity of 25-32 mAh, with certain low drain variants having capacity up to 45 mAh.
